summ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Carsten Haitzler (Rasterman) <raster@rasterman.com>2021-05-19 18:35:51 +0100
committerCarsten Haitzler (Rasterman) <raster@rasterman.com>2021-05-19 18:35:51 +0100
commit883cf23cebbd2783d03c98f29f74dd9a4df8e868 (patch)
tree5f9db6357919eb5333b4032c389a7cfa98120f8e
parenteb9f23979b0417404c06c382304e44dd6474c59e (diff)
downloadenlightenment-883cf23cebbd2783d03c98f29f74dd9a4df8e868.tar.gz
move a bunch of public runnable tools into src/bin/tools
-rw-r--r--meson.build1
-rw-r--r--src/bin/meson.build23
-rw-r--r--src/bin/tools/askpass/e_askpass_main.c (renamed from src/bin/e_askpass_main.c)0
-rw-r--r--src/bin/tools/askpass/meson.build6
-rw-r--r--src/bin/tools/filemanager/e_fm_cmdline.c (renamed from src/bin/e_fm_cmdline.c)0
-rw-r--r--src/bin/tools/filemanager/meson.build7
-rw-r--r--src/bin/tools/meson.build4
-rw-r--r--src/bin/tools/open/e_open.c (renamed from src/bin/e_open.c)0
-rw-r--r--src/bin/tools/open/meson.build7
-rw-r--r--src/bin/tools/paledit/enlightenment_paledit.desktop6
-rwxr-xr-xsrc/bin/tools/remote/enlightenment_remote (renamed from data/tools/enlightenment_remote)0
-rw-r--r--src/bin/tools/remote/meson.build (renamed from data/tools/meson.build)0
12 files changed, 27 insertions, 27 deletions
diff --git a/meson.build b/meson.build
index 05aa687e4f..08187e9557 100644
--- a/meson.build
+++ b/meson.build
@@ -399,7 +399,6 @@ subdir('data/fonts')
subdir('data/icons')
subdir('data/images')
subdir('data/input_methods')
-subdir('data/tools')
subdir('data/units')
subdir('data/session')
diff --git a/src/bin/meson.build b/src/bin/meson.build
index 6f086e116e..c530c9333e 100644
--- a/src/bin/meson.build
+++ b/src/bin/meson.build
@@ -471,29 +471,6 @@ executable('enlightenment_start',
install : true
)
-executable('enlightenment_filemanager',
- [ 'e_fm_cmdline.c' ],
- include_directories: include_directories('../..'),
- dependencies : [ dep_eina, dep_ecore, dep_ecore_file, dep_eldbus, dep_efreet ],
- install_dir : dir_bin,
- install : true
- )
-
-executable('enlightenment_open',
- [ 'e_open.c' ],
- include_directories: include_directories('../..'),
- dependencies : [ dep_eina, dep_ecore, dep_efreet, dep_efreet_mime ],
- install_dir : dir_bin,
- install : true
- )
-
-executable('enlightenment_askpass',
- [ 'e_askpass_main.c' ],
- dependencies: [ dep_elementary ],
- install_dir : dir_bin,
- install : true
- )
-
executable('enlightenment_fm_op',
[ 'e_fm_op.c' ],
include_directories: include_directories('../..'),
diff --git a/src/bin/e_askpass_main.c b/src/bin/tools/askpass/e_askpass_main.c
index f16f460dbf..f16f460dbf 100644
--- a/src/bin/e_askpass_main.c
+++ b/src/bin/tools/askpass/e_askpass_main.c
diff --git a/src/bin/tools/askpass/meson.build b/src/bin/tools/askpass/meson.build
new file mode 100644
index 0000000000..fe161636da
--- /dev/null
+++ b/src/bin/tools/askpass/meson.build
@@ -0,0 +1,6 @@
+executable('enlightenment_askpass',
+ [ 'e_askpass_main.c' ],
+ dependencies: [ dep_elementary ],
+ install_dir : dir_bin,
+ install : true
+ )
diff --git a/src/bin/e_fm_cmdline.c b/src/bin/tools/filemanager/e_fm_cmdline.c
index bf710d2a45..bf710d2a45 100644
--- a/src/bin/e_fm_cmdline.c
+++ b/src/bin/tools/filemanager/e_fm_cmdline.c
diff --git a/src/bin/tools/filemanager/meson.build b/src/bin/tools/filemanager/meson.build
new file mode 100644
index 0000000000..f9523b98c4
--- /dev/null
+++ b/src/bin/tools/filemanager/meson.build
@@ -0,0 +1,7 @@
+executable('enlightenment_filemanager',
+ [ 'e_fm_cmdline.c' ],
+ include_directories: include_directories('../../../..'),
+ dependencies : [ dep_eina, dep_ecore, dep_ecore_file, dep_eldbus, dep_efreet ],
+ install_dir : dir_bin,
+ install : true
+ )
diff --git a/src/bin/tools/meson.build b/src/bin/tools/meson.build
index d694873f22..767cc22749 100644
--- a/src/bin/tools/meson.build
+++ b/src/bin/tools/meson.build
@@ -1 +1,5 @@
subdir('paledit')
+subdir('filemanager')
+subdir('open')
+subdir('askpass')
+subdir('remote')
diff --git a/src/bin/e_open.c b/src/bin/tools/open/e_open.c
index 3a679fbcb4..3a679fbcb4 100644
--- a/src/bin/e_open.c
+++ b/src/bin/tools/open/e_open.c
diff --git a/src/bin/tools/open/meson.build b/src/bin/tools/open/meson.build
new file mode 100644
index 0000000000..a9e1dde2be
--- /dev/null
+++ b/src/bin/tools/open/meson.build
@@ -0,0 +1,7 @@
+executable('enlightenment_open',
+ [ 'e_open.c' ],
+ include_directories: include_directories('../../../..'),
+ dependencies : [ dep_eina, dep_ecore, dep_efreet, dep_efreet_mime ],
+ install_dir : dir_bin,
+ install : true
+ )
diff --git a/src/bin/tools/paledit/enlightenment_paledit.desktop b/src/bin/tools/paledit/enlightenment_paledit.desktop
index abe8ca22a3..a48228bb25 100644
--- a/src/bin/tools/paledit/enlightenment_paledit.desktop
+++ b/src/bin/tools/paledit/enlightenment_paledit.desktop
@@ -3,10 +3,10 @@ Type=Application
Name=Palette Editor
Name[fr]=Éditeur de palette
Name[it]=Editor della palette
-Icon=e_paledit
-Exec=e_paledit
+Icon=enlightenment_paledit
+Exec=enlightenment_paledit
Comment=A tool for editing color schemes and palette for Enlightenment
Comment[fr]=Outil d'édition des jeux de couleurs et palette pour Enlightenment
Comment[it]=Strumento per la modifica degli schemi colore e palette per Enlightenment
Categories=Settings;DesktopSettings;
-StartupWMClass=e_paledit
+StartupWMClass=enlightenment_paledit
diff --git a/data/tools/enlightenment_remote b/src/bin/tools/remote/enlightenment_remote
index 9a4b3aa6b8..9a4b3aa6b8 100755
--- a/data/tools/enlightenment_remote
+++ b/src/bin/tools/remote/enlightenment_remote
diff --git a/data/tools/meson.build b/src/bin/tools/remote/meson.build
index e95fd365de..e95fd365de 100644
--- a/data/tools/meson.build
+++ b/src/bin/tools/remote/meson.build